- Bell County Courthouse hosts meetings and workshops on a variety of matters, such as jail maintenance and building and ground updates. It is a part of Commissioners Court, which is the governing body of Bell County in Texas. The court serves as the legislative and executive branches of the county s government. In addition, Commissioners Court has budgetary authority over various departments. Incorporated in 1852, Bell County focuses on judicial system, law enforcement, road construction, and health and social service delivery. The county governs an engineer s office that is responsible for drawing plans and writing specifications and estimates. The office also offers stormwater management services.
